Step 4: Update canary gating rules

After migrating to the new Fennelworth rollout controller, the old percentage-based gates no longer apply. Gating is now evaluated per metric window, and promotion halts automatically on two consecutive failing windows. New team members should note that rollback is immediate and requires no approval. Apply the following configuration block to the controller before enabling traffic shifting.

settings of fajop-fahap:
[holeth]
port = 9300
team = juleth
host = holeth.tolvaqsoft.example
region = south-4
access_code = ac_4bcdf6
timeout_ms = 500

Subject: Key rotation — webhook relay

Welcome aboard. We rotated the Hooksmith relay key today. Reminder on retries: deliveries back off exponentially, max five attempts, then dead-letter. Duplicate deliveries are possible, so keep your handlers idempotent. Update your local config before testing against staging. The new relay key follows.

gateway credential: kto23_LX9A4ys6i4nzHtpOLNLodKK

Welcome to the Tallyfern points team. The loyalty ledger (service: pointsledge) is append-only; never mutate rows. All balance changes go through the accrual queue. Deploys require a signed manifest — staging first, always. Read the ledger invariants doc before your first PR. To push a release, you'll need the deploy key used by the pointsledge pipeline, shown below.

rollout seal: bky4_x7Gc